However, when people use marijuana they can start to crave it, and they can become irritable. It as well causes their appetite to be affected because it causes people to be hungry even more than usual, and give them what they call the “munchies” causing more eating and can affect their diet. Again 9 to 10 % of people can develop a dependence to the drug which when it comes to adolescents can increase to 17%. Now there are different kinds of marijuana such as synthetic marijuana. Which is where there are more chemicals in them, one of those is called Spice. Due to the fact that it is different than other types of marijuana the effects of it can be completely different than typical marijuana. Some of those effects include vomiting, chest pains, seizures and others. There is also the fact that these synthetic drugs don’t routinely show up on drug test, this makes it more appealing to people who might have to have drug test.
